China Plastic Packaging Market Analysis by Mordor Intelligence

The China plastic packaging market size is 15.14 million tons in 2025 and is projected to reach 18.65 million tons by 2030, translating to a 4.26% CAGR. Sustained e-commerce expansion, cold-chain penetration, and recycled-content mandates underpin the steady trajectory, while down-gauging techniques and digital printing bolster cost efficiency and brand agility. Stiffer provincial VOC rules raise compliance costs, but smart-factory investments in inland clusters cut freight lead-times and unlock new customers. Multinational majors and well-capitalized domestic players are therefore widening competitive moats, even as carbon-border measures reshape export flows. Segment Analysis

By Material Type: PET Recycling Drives Growth Acceleration

Polyethylene continued to command 40.65% of the China plastic packaging market size in 2024, underpinned by its processability and cost advantage across food pouches, stretch films, and commodity containers. Polyethylene terephthalate is the clear volume gainer, propelled by a 6.32% CAGR to 2030, as beverage bottlers embrace closed-loop recycling and cosmetics brands prefer transparent, premium-looking jar .

Multi-layer barrier coatings now elevate PET’s oxygen-scavenging properties, opening doors in medicine and high-value cosmetics. Chemical recycling platforms co-developed by Sinopec produce 100,000 tons per year of food-grade rPET pellets, directly feeding converters with secure supply. Conversely, polystyrene is losing share because dine-in chains shun foam clamshells to meet provincial bans. Bio-based PLA, PHA, and other niche resins gain pilot-scale traction in cutlery and snack wrappers, yet their collective volume remains below 2% of the market given higher cost and processing barriers.

By Packaging Type: Flexible Solutions Dominate Innovation

Flexible formats comprised 55.86% of the overall volume in 2024 and are forecast to outpace rigid alternatives at a 6.75% CAGR. Brands appreciate lower shipping costs, evolving from 20 g PET bottles to 8 g mono-PE spouted pouches for household cleaners. At the same time, recyclability gains as single-material laminates replace mixed-substrate snack bags.

Rigid packaging retains relevance in carbonated drinks, injectables, and heavy-duty industrial polymer drums where structural integrity is paramount. Lightweighting in blow-molded bottles has trimmed gram weights by 10% since 2023, but flexible stand-up pouches still undercut total packaging mass by at least 30%. Moreover, flexible form-fill-seal systems facilitate shorter production runs aligned with mass-customized marketing, whereas rigid lines demand higher changeover cost and downtime.

By Product Form: Films Drive E-Commerce Growth

Pouches and sachets led with 36.36% share in 2024 owing to portion-control convenience across condiments, nutraceuticals, and trial-size cosmetics. Yet, stretch and shrink films are expanding faster, riding a 5.21% CAGR as omnichannel retailers wrap mixed-SKU parcels and perishable food crates for cross-provincial shipping.

Advances in nano-clay and EVOH co-extrusion provide high oxygen barriers while preserving transparency, essential for ready-meal trays displayed through last-mile cold-chain. Films also benefit from post-industrial scrap recycling loops that are simpler than multi-layer pouches. Bottles remain the workhorse for beverages and OTC pharmaceuticals, but composite materials like PET-aluminum integrate foil layers, complicating recovery. Trays gain share in premium bakery and fresh-cut produce, especially when thermoformed from rPET sheets certified for direct food contact.

By End-User Industry: Cosmetics Accelerate Premium Trends

Food maintained a 29.42% lead in 2024, fueled by the spread of convenience retail formats and frozen meal uptake across urban centers. Yet cosmetics and personal-care products are sprinting ahead, rising at a 6.56% CAGR as Gen-Z consumers gravitate toward premium serums packaged in glossy, recyclable containers.

Sustainability messaging drives refill-and-reuse schemes for skin-care jars, often executed with mono-material PP inserts that snap into decorated outer shells. Beverage players push toward aseptic pouches for dairy and functional drinks, partly to cut cold-chain logistics. Pharmaceuticals rely on stringent ISO-class cleanroom packaging, cushioning demand for multilayer blister packs and injection vials. Industrial segments such as automotive lubricants and agrochemicals increasingly specify UN-certified drums molded from high-molecular-weight HDPE to satisfy hazardous-goods transit rules.

By Manufacturing Process: Thermoforming Gains Precision Applications

Extrusion held a 27.43% share in 2024 on its ubiquity for film and sheet production that feeds bag-making, lamination, and thermoforming. Thermoforming, however, is growing fastest at 5.78% CAGR because retailers demand rigid trays with intricate geometry for shelf-ready presentation.

Modern servo-driven thermoformers cut cycle times while slashing trim waste, allowing thinner gauges and rPET content exceeding 60%. Injection molding supports fine-thread bottle necks and child-resistant caps for pharmaceuticals, whereas stretch-blow molding sustains light-weighted PET bottles. Industry 4.0 deployments integrate sensors and predictive analytics across extrusion, printing, and converting lines, enabling closed-loop process adjustments that boost yields and reduce off-grade scrap.

Geography Analysis

Eastern seaboard provinces Shanghai, Jiangsu, and Zhejiang produced roughly 60% of the China plastic packaging market in 2024, leveraging dense supplier parks, skilled labor, and port access. Pearl River Delta clusters in Guangdong specialize in export-oriented rigid containers and industrial sacks but face escalating wage bills and stringent emission controls.

Central megacities such as Chongqing, Chengdu, and Wuhan now attract greenfield investments with 30% lower land costs and newly commissioned high-speed rail lines that compress east-west transit to under 48 hours. Government tax breaks and renewable-power availability bolster project economics, prompting majors to relocate growth capacity inland. This inland pivot enables consumer-goods brands to replenish western store shelves faster, trimming stock-out risk.

Northern provinces including Hebei and Tianjin concentrate on medical, pharmaceutical, and frozen-food applications, benefitting from proximity to national drug manufacturers and grain processing hubs. Yet heightened air-quality campaigns enforce stricter VOC baselines, compelling converters to upgrade solvent-based ink lines or switch to water-based systems. Border regions adjoining ASEAN capture incremental demand by exporting laminates and wraps under the Regional Comprehensive Economic Partnership, though compliance with origin rules requires localized resin sourcing.

Competitive Landscape

The China plastic packaging market is moderately concentrated, with the top five groups controlling roughly 45-50% of domestic output. Amcor, Berry Global, and Huhtamaki retain technological leadership via high-barrier structures, digital printing assets, and food-grade recycling plants. Domestic challengers Zhuhai Zhongfu, COFCO Packaging, and Southern Packaging Group leverage agile decision-making and low overhead to under-price imports while meeting strict lead-times.[3]Shanghai Stock Exchange, “Listed Company Performance Analysis 2024,” SSE.COM.CN

Sustainability is a focal point of competition. COFCO’s chemical-recycling venture with Sinopec guarantees captive rPET supply, underpinning beverage contracts. Amcor’s Suzhou expansion lifts flexible-pack capacity by 40% and introduces solvent-free lamination that aligns with provincial emission caps. Berry Global’s 2024 buy-out of Guangdong Danjia adds rigid tubs and thin-wall IML know-how, broadening its FMCG portfolio.

Innovation intensity is rising: Chinese converters filed 34% more packaging patents in 2024 than 2023, with emphasis on barrier coatings, bio-based resins, and digital-workflow automation. Capital expenditure increasingly flows to robotics and AI-powered inspection, elevating consistent quality while mitigating labor shortages. Exporters, however, face looming EU CBAM levies that favor converters able to certify low-carbon footprints.

Recent Industry Developments

  • January 2025: Amcor announced a CNY 800 million (USD 112 million) expansion of its Suzhou plant to lift flexible packaging capacity by 40%, including chemical-recycling and digital-printing modules.
  • December 2024: Berry Global completed the CNY 1.2 billion (USD 168 million) acquisition of Guangdong Danjia Plastic Packaging to deepen rigid-pack exposure in southern China.
  • November 2024: Huhtamaki invested CNY 600 million (USD 84 million) in a new thermoforming site in Chengdu aimed at food-service and ready-meal contracts in western China.
  • October 2024: COFCO Packaging launched a CNY 500 million (USD 70 million) rPET joint venture with Sinopec to service beverage clients under recycled-content mandates.

Key Questions Answered in the Report

How fast is the China plastic packaging market expected to grow through 2030?

Volume is projected to expand from 15.14 million tons in 2025 to 18.65 million tons by 2030, reflecting a 4.26% CAGR.

Which packaging format is expanding quickest in China?

Flexible solutions, especially stand-up pouches and high-barrier films, are leading growth at a 6.75% CAGR to 2030.

What role does recycled PET play in beverage packaging?

Recycled PET is gaining traction because the 2025 Plastic-Pollution Action Plan mandates 30% recycled content, prompting chemical-recycling investments and supply agreements with beverage bottlers.

Why are inland provinces attracting new packaging plants?

Lower land costs, improved rail links, and tax incentives cut freight lead-times and operating expenses, enticing converters to relocate capacity from the crowded coast.

How are converters mitigating feedstock price swings?

Larger players hedge long-term resin contracts, diversify into recycled materials, and invest in process efficiencies that reduce resin consumption by up to 20%.

Which end-user segment is set to outpace food in growth terms?

Cosmetics and personal care packaging is poised for a 6.56% CAGR, fueled by premium product launches and consumer preference for sustainable, visually appealing packs.
